    Torque-and-Angle Measuring Socket Adapters

    Image of Product. Front orientation. Socket Adapters. Torque-and-Angle Measuring Socket Adapters.
    A digital display shows how torque measurements change as you turn the wrench. Set the desired torque and angle—lights and an audible alarm indicate when target has been reached or exceeded.
    Note: The accuracy ratings do not apply to the lower 10% of the torque range.

    Torque-Measuring Bit Adapters

    Image of Product. Front orientation. Bit Adapters. Torque-Measuring Bit Adapters.
    Eliminate the need for multiple bulky tools with these bit adapters. At less than 3 inches long, these compact adapters convert 1/4" bit screwdriver handles and 1/4" bits into torque screwdrivers so you can fasten to a specific torque. Insert your drive handle and turn clockwise until the hash marks line up with the torque value you need. Not for use with power tools.
